  1. JF1 DETERMINE WHICH COIL IS NOT FIRING PROPERLY 
    NOTE: Electronic ignition engine timing is entirely controlled by the PCM. Electronic ignition timing is NOT adjustable. Do not attempt to check base timing. You will receive false readings.
    • Determine which coil is not firing properly using the information from Pinpoint Test JB or a DTC and the table at the beginning of this pinpoint test.
    • Record the suspect cylinder, coil and PCM pin number from the table.
    • Is the suspect cylinder number, coil driver and PCM pin number recorded? 
    Yes No
    GO to  JF2. REPEAT the test step to obtain the required information.
  2. JF2 CHECK THE FUNCTIONALITY OF THE SUSPECT COIL DRIVER CIRCUIT 
    NOTE: This step may cause fuel pump related DTCs to set. Disregard any fuel pump related DTCs at this time.
    NOTE: Test lamp bulb filament wattages vary widely. The intensity and duration of blinking depends on the test lamp being used.
    • Key in OFF position.
    • Suspect coil connector disconnected.
    • Remove the fuel pump fuse to disable the fuel pump.
    • Connect a non-powered test lamp between the IGN START/RUN and suspect coil driver, harness side.
    • Observe the test lamp while cranking the engine.
    • Is the test lamp blinking consistently? 
    Yes No
    GO to  JF3. GO to  JF4.
  3. JF3 CHECK THE FUNCTIONALITY OF THE SUSPECT COIL 
    • Key in OFF position.
    • Carry out a visual inspection. Closely inspect the coil case and boot for carbon tracking, cracks and torn or improperly installed boots.
    • Remove the suspect COP from the spark plug.
    • Connect the Air Gap Spark Tester 303-DO37 (D81P-6666-A) or equivalent.
    • Suspect coil connector connected.
    • Crank the engine.
    • Observe the spark tester while cranking the engine.
    • Is a bluish-white spark present? 
    Yes No
    refer to PINPOINT TEST Z . INSTALL a new suspect coil. If necessary, INSTALL a new spark plug. REFER to the ENGINE IGNITION article.
    CLEAR the DTCs. REPEAT the self-test.
  4. JF4 CHECK THE IGN START/RUN VOLTAGE TO THE SUSPECT COIL 
    • Key ON, engine OFF.
    • Suspect coil connector disconnected.
    • Measure the voltage between:
      ( + ) COP Connector, Harness Side ( - ) Vehicle Battery
      IGN START/RUN Negative terminal
    • Is the voltage greater than 10 V? 
    Yes No
    GO to  JF5. For Crown Victoria,
    Grand Marquis, and
    Town Car, GO to  JF9.
    For all others, REPAIR the open circuit.
    CLEAR the DTCs. REPEAT the self-test.
  5. JF5 CHECK THE SUSPECT COIL DRIVER CIRCUIT FOR AN OPEN IN THE HARNESS 
    • Key in OFF position.
    • PCM connector disconnected.
    • Suspect coil connector disconnected.
    • Measure the resistance between:
      ( + ) PCM Connector, Harness Side ( - ) COP Connector, Harness Side
      Suspect coil driver COP
    • Is the resistance less than 5 ohms? 
    Yes No
    GO to  JF6. REPAIR the open circuit. CLEAR the DTCs. REPEAT the self-test.
  6. JF6 CHECK THE SUSPECT COIL DRIVER CIRCUIT FOR A SHORT TO VOLTAGE IN THE HARNESS 
    • Key ON, engine OFF.
    • Measure the voltage between:
      ( + ) PCM Connector, Harness Side ( - ) Vehicle Battery
      Suspect coil driver Negative terminal
    • Is the voltage less than 1 V? 
    Yes No
    GO to  JF7. REPAIR the short circuit. CLEAR the DTCs. REPEAT the self-test.
  7. JF7 CHECK THE SUSPECT COIL DRIVER CIRCUIT FOR A SHORT TO GROUND IN THE HARNESS 
    • Key in OFF position.
    • Measure the resistance between:
      ( + ) PCM Connector, Harness Side ( - ) Vehicle Battery
      Suspect coil driver Negative terminal
    • Is the resistance greater than 10K ohms? 
    Yes No
    GO to  JF12. REPAIR the short circuit. CLEAR the DTCs. REPEAT the self-test. If the concern or DTC is still present,
    GO to  JF8.
  8. JF8 CHECK THE SUSPECT COIL FOR DAMAGE 
    • PCM connector connected.
    • Connect the Air Gap Spark Tester 303-D037 (D81P-6666-A) or equivalent to the suspect coil.
    • Crank the engine while the accelerator pedal is fully applied.
    • Observe the spark tester while cranking the engine.
    • Is a bluish-white spark present? 
    Yes No
    If necessary, INSTALL a new spark plug. REFER to the ENGINE IGNITION article.
    CLEAR the DTCs. REPEAT the self-test.
    INSTALL a new suspect coil. REFER to the ENGINE IGNITION article.
    CLEAR the DTCs. REPEAT the self-test.
  9. JF9 CHECK VPWR CIRCUIT CONTINUITY BETWEEN THE SUSPECT COIL AND IGNITION COILS RELAY 
    • Key in OFF position.
    • Ignition Coils Relay connector disconnected.
    • Measure the resistance between:
      ( + ) Ignition Coils Relay Connector, Harness Side ( - ) Suspect coil Connector, Harness Side
      VPWR - Pin 3 IGN START/RUN
    • Is the resistance less than 5 ohms? 
    Yes No
    GO to  JF10. REPAIR the open circuit. The open is between the splice and the ignition coils relay.
    CLEAR the DTCs. REPEAT the self-test.
  10. JF10 CHECK THE B+ AND IGN START/RUN VOLTAGE TO IGNITION COILS RELAY 
    • Key ON, engine OFF.
    • Measure the voltage between:
      ( + ) Ignition Coils Relay Connector, Harness Side ( - )
      B+ - Pin 5 Ground
      IGN START/RUN - Pin 2 Ground
    • Are the voltages greater than 10 V? 
    Yes No
    GO to  JF11. REPAIR the open circuit. CLEAR the DTCs. REPEAT the self-test.
  11. JF11 CHECK THE IGNITION COILS RELAY GND CIRCUIT FOR AN OPEN IN THE HARNESS 
    • Measure the voltage between:
      ( + ) Ignition Coils Relay Connector, Harness Side ( - ) Ignition Coils Relay Connector, Harness Side
      B+ - Pin 5 GND - Pin 1
    • Is the voltage greater than 10 V? 
    Yes No
    INSTALL a new Ignition Coils relay. CLEAR the DTCs. REPEAT the self-test. REPAIR the open circuit. CLEAR the DTCs. REPEAT the self-test.
  12. JF12 CHECK FOR CORRECT PCM OPERATION 
    • Disconnect all the PCM connectors.
    • Visually inspect for:
      • pushed out pins
      • corrosion
    • Connect all the PCM connectors and make sure they seat correctly.
    • Carry out the PCM self-test and verify the concern is still present.
    • Is the concern still present? 
    Yes No
    INSTALL a new PCM.
    REFER toFLASH ELECTRICALLY ERASABLE PROGRAMMABLE READ ONLY MEMORY (EEPROM) , Programming the VID Block for a Replacement PCM.
    The system is operating correctly at this time. The concern may have been caused by a loose or corroded connector.
